The India Gas Genset Market is expected to witness healthy growth as the emphasis on clean energy develops, along with more reliable power and rapid industrialization. The growing use of natural gas and biogas-based generator sets in place of diesel is creating considerable opportunity. Urbanization, infrastructure development, and distributed or localized energy generation are all spurring adoption in the industrial, commercial, and residential segments. Furthermore, the growth of the market across the country is being supported by government initiatives focused on increasing gas pipeline delivery infrastructure and reducing emissions.
Below mentioned are some prominent drivers and their influence on the India Gas Genset Market dynamics:
| Drivers | Primary Segments Affected | Why it Matters (Evidence) |
| Growing Natural Gas Availability | Industrial, Commercial | Expansion of CGD (City Gas Distribution) networks ensures consistent fuel supply for gas gensets. |
| Transition Toward Cleaner Power Solutions | All Verticals | Shift from diesel to gas gensets supports India’s emission reduction targets under National Clean Energy Policy. |
| Rising Power Demand in Industrial & Commercial Sectors | Industrial, Commercial | Increasing power outages and demand for continuous energy drive genset installations. |
| Supportive Government Initiatives (PNGRB, Ujjwal Bharat 2047) | All Verticals | Policies promoting natural gas infrastructure and clean fuel usage enhance genset deployment. |
| Advancement in Hybrid and CHP Systems | Industrial, Commercial | Integration of combined heat and power (CHP) systems improves efficiency and fuel savings. |

Below mentioned are some major restraints and their influence on the India Gas Genset Market dynamics:
| Restraints | Primary Segments Affected | What this Means (Evidence) |
| High Initial Installation Cost | Industrial, Commercial | Higher capital cost than diesel gensets restricts adoption among small users. |
| Limited Gas Pipeline Connectivity in Remote Areas | Residential, Eastern Region | Lack of infrastructure limits availability of gas in non-urban zones. |
| Intermittent Gas Supply & Price Fluctuations | Industrial | Dependence on gas distribution networks creates operational uncertainty. |
| Low Consumer Awareness About Long-Term Benefits | Residential | Perception of high cost hinders awareness about lifecycle savings. |
| Competition from Diesel Gensets | All Verticals | Diesel generators still dominate due to low upfront cost and widespread service networks. |

According to Indian Government data, The Government of India has implemented several initiatives to encourage clean energy and efficient backup power sourcing. Furthermore, under the Pradhan Mantri Urja Ganga Project, gas pipeline networks have extended throughout several regions. The Ujjwal Bharat 2047 and National Green Hydrogen Mission facilitate the transition to clean fuel, encouraging industry to shift to gas-based gensets. The PNGRB City Gas Distribution Policy seeks to enhance access to natural gas for commercial and industrial power needs and supports market growth directly.

According to Ritika Kalra, Senior Research Analyst, 6Wresearch, 375.1 kVA–1,000 kVA gensets are projected to dominate the India Gas Genset Market Share due to their high demand in industrial and commercial sectors requiring stable continuous power. These gensets offer optimized efficiency for large-scale operations and are preferred for industries like manufacturing, data centers, and hospitality, where uninterrupted power is critical.
Industrial applications lead the market owing to rising investments in manufacturing, oil & gas, and processing industries. The sector requires reliable and sustainable power backup to maintain production continuity. Commercial and residential sectors are growing steadily, driven by urbanization and smart building projects that increasingly favor gas gensets for their eco-friendly performance.
Standby Power holds the largest share due to the widespread use of gas gensets in commercial complexes, hospitals, and industrial plants for emergency backup. Primary Power applications are growing in remote industrial zones and gas-powered captive plants, while Peak Shaving is emerging in energy-intensive facilities optimizing grid costs.
The Western region dominates the India Gas Genset Market due to strong industrial infrastructure in Maharashtra and Gujarat, supported by developed CGD networks and high commercial power consumption. The Southern region follows closely with rising adoption across IT hubs and manufacturing clusters, while Northern and Eastern regions are witnessing gradual expansion with ongoing pipeline connectivity improvements.

India gas Genset market recorded a declining trend over the past 2-3 years owing to lower product awareness coupled with strict emission norms by the Central Pollution Control Board (CPCB) of India. However, surging environmental awareness is predicted to result in a consumer shift from diesel Genset towards gas Genset over the coming years. Further, the gas Genset market is projected to recover in near future on account of improving gas pipeline infrastructure in the country along with government efforts towards creating consumer awareness regarding environment-friendly products, development of City Gas Distribution (CGD) network, and subsidy on using renewable resources.
According to 6Wresearch, India gas Genset market size is projected to reach $31 million by 2024. Due to the launch of new norms, the market, especially in industrial verticals which includes the power utility segment, was majorly impacted during the last few years. This also resulted in increased prices of gas Gensets, which further impacted the growth of the market during 2014-17. Standby power applications bagged the highest India gas Genset market share in 2017, while peak shaving and primary power applications contributed nearly 15% altogether.

Furthermore, in terms of gas Genset rating, the 375.1 kVA-1000 kVA segment captured the largest India gas Genset market revenue share while low rating Genset up to 100 kVA attributed to the largest market volume share in 2017. With the ongoing demand for medium rating gas Genset from commercial and industrial segments, the 100.1 kVA-375 kVA segment is projected to exhibit high growth during the forecast period.
